Description:
Zinc Ribbon Anode is consists of galvanized steel wire core, wrapped by extruded high-grade zinc (SHG).
Zinc ribbon anodes provide a simple, cost effective, low maintenance method of corrosion control. So zinc ribbon anodes are especially useful for unattended applications , such as : Steel Pipe, Insulated flange, other steel structures under tower
Feature:
1. High output current to volume ratio
2. High current efficiency>95%
3. Even distribution of current density due to continuous ribbon formation
4. Self-regulating current output
5. Excellent tensile strength and hardness
6. Easily cut to length
7. Product flexibility ensures installation in Coldweather(-22/-30℃)
Application:
Zinc ribbon anodes are used for cathodic protection on buried pipelines,for example:
1. AC. mitigation on pipelines,
2. Sacrificial cathodic protection of secondary bottoms on above-ground storage tanks,
3. A.C. mitigation grounding mats and for other corrosion protection applications.
Chemical Compositions of Zinc Anode:
Chemical Composition: | TYPE I | TYPE II |
Aluminium (Al) | 0.1 - 0.5% | 0.005% max. |
Cadmium (Cd) | 0.02 - 0.07% | 0.003% max. |
Iron (Fe) | 0.005% max. | 0.001% max. |
Lead (Pb) | 0.006% max. | 0.003% max. |
Copper (Cu) | 0.005% max. | 0.002% max. |
Zinc (Zn) | balance | balance |
Electrochemical Properties:
Electrochemistry Capability: | TYPE I | TYPE II |
Open - Circuit Voltage (-V) : | 1.05 | 1.10 |
Closed - Circuit Voltage (-V) : | 1.00 | 1.05 |
Actually Capability (A.h/lb): | ≥ 353 | ≥ 335 |
Efficiency: | ≥ 95% | ≥ 90% |
